60f7b77691SDoug Rabson static int kobj_next_id = 1;
61f7b77691SDoug Rabson 
62f7b77691SDoug Rabson static int
63f7b77691SDoug Rabson kobj_error_method(void)
64f7b77691SDoug Rabson {
65f7b77691SDoug Rabson 	return ENXIO;
66f7b77691SDoug Rabson }
67f7b77691SDoug Rabson 
68f7b77691SDoug Rabson static void
69f7b77691SDoug Rabson kobj_register_method(struct kobjop_desc *desc)
70f7b77691SDoug Rabson {
71f7b77691SDoug Rabson 	if (desc->id == 0)
72f7b77691SDoug Rabson 		desc->id = kobj_next_id++;
73f7b77691SDoug Rabson }
74f7b77691SDoug Rabson 
75f7b77691SDoug Rabson static void
76f7b77691SDoug Rabson kobj_unregister_method(struct kobjop_desc *desc)
77f7b77691SDoug Rabson {
78f7b77691SDoug Rabson }
79f7b77691SDoug Rabson 
80f7b77691SDoug Rabson void
81f7b77691SDoug Rabson kobj_class_compile(kobj_class_t cls)
82f7b77691SDoug Rabson {
83f7b77691SDoug Rabson 	kobj_ops_t ops;
84f7b77691SDoug Rabson 	kobj_method_t *m;
85f7b77691SDoug Rabson 	int i;
86f7b77691SDoug Rabson 
87f7b77691SDoug Rabson 	/*
88f7b77691SDoug Rabson 	 * Don't do anything if we are already compiled.
89f7b77691SDoug Rabson 	 */
90f7b77691SDoug Rabson 	if (cls->ops)
91f7b77691SDoug Rabson 		return;
92f7b77691SDoug Rabson 
93f7b77691SDoug Rabson 	/*
94f7b77691SDoug Rabson 	 * First register any methods which need it.
95f7b77691SDoug Rabson 	 */
96f7b77691SDoug Rabson 	for (i = 0, m = cls->methods; m->desc; i++, m++)
97f7b77691SDoug Rabson 		kobj_register_method(m->desc);
98f7b77691SDoug Rabson 
99f7b77691SDoug Rabson 	/*
100f7b77691SDoug Rabson 	 * Then allocate the compiled op table.
101f7b77691SDoug Rabson 	 */
102f7b77691SDoug Rabson 	ops = malloc(sizeof(struct kobj_ops), M_KOBJ, M_NOWAIT);
103f7b77691SDoug Rabson 	if (!ops)
104f7b77691SDoug Rabson 		panic("kobj_compile_methods: out of memory");
105f7b77691SDoug Rabson 	bzero(ops, sizeof(struct kobj_ops));
106f7b77691SDoug Rabson 	ops->cls = cls;
107f7b77691SDoug Rabson 	cls->ops = ops;
108f7b77691SDoug Rabson }
109f7b77691SDoug Rabson 
110f7b77691SDoug Rabson void
111f7b77691SDoug Rabson kobj_lookup_method(kobj_method_t *methods,
112f7b77691SDoug Rabson 		   kobj_method_t *ce,
113f7b77691SDoug Rabson 		   kobjop_desc_t desc)
114f7b77691SDoug Rabson {
115f7b77691SDoug Rabson 	ce->desc = desc;
116f7b77691SDoug Rabson 	for (; methods && methods->desc; methods++) {
117f7b77691SDoug Rabson 		if (methods->desc == desc) {
118f7b77691SDoug Rabson 			ce->func = methods->func;
119f7b77691SDoug Rabson 			return;
120f7b77691SDoug Rabson 		}
121f7b77691SDoug Rabson 	}
122f7b77691SDoug Rabson 	if (desc->deflt)
123f7b77691SDoug Rabson 		ce->func = desc->deflt;
124f7b77691SDoug Rabson 	else
125f7b77691SDoug Rabson 		ce->func = kobj_error_method;
126f7b77691SDoug Rabson 	return;
127f7b77691SDoug Rabson }
128f7b77691SDoug Rabson 
129f7b77691SDoug Rabson void
130f7b77691SDoug Rabson kobj_class_free(kobj_class_t cls)
131f7b77691SDoug Rabson {
132f7b77691SDoug Rabson 	int i;
133f7b77691SDoug Rabson 	kobj_method_t *m;
134f7b77691SDoug Rabson 
135f7b77691SDoug Rabson 	/*
136f7b77691SDoug Rabson 	 * Unregister any methods which are no longer used.
137f7b77691SDoug Rabson 	 */
138f7b77691SDoug Rabson 	for (i = 0, m = cls->methods; m->desc; i++, m++)
139f7b77691SDoug Rabson 		kobj_unregister_method(m->desc);
140f7b77691SDoug Rabson 
141f7b77691SDoug Rabson 	/*
142f7b77691SDoug Rabson 	 * Free memory and clean up.
143f7b77691SDoug Rabson 	 */
144f7b77691SDoug Rabson 	free(cls->ops, M_KOBJ);
145f7b77691SDoug Rabson 	cls->ops = 0;
146f7b77691SDoug Rabson }
147f7b77691SDoug Rabson 
148f7b77691SDoug Rabson kobj_t
149f7b77691SDoug Rabson kobj_create(kobj_class_t cls,
150f7b77691SDoug Rabson 	    struct malloc_type *mtype,
151f7b77691SDoug Rabson 	    int mflags)
152f7b77691SDoug Rabson {
153f7b77691SDoug Rabson 	kobj_t obj;
154f7b77691SDoug Rabson 
155f7b77691SDoug Rabson 	/*
156f7b77691SDoug Rabson 	 * Allocate and initialise the new object.
157f7b77691SDoug Rabson 	 */
158f7b77691SDoug Rabson 	obj = malloc(cls->size, mtype, mflags);
159f7b77691SDoug Rabson 	if (!obj)
160f7b77691SDoug Rabson 		return 0;
161f7b77691SDoug Rabson 	bzero(obj, cls->size);
162f7b77691SDoug Rabson 	kobj_init(obj, cls);
163f7b77691SDoug Rabson 
164f7b77691SDoug Rabson 	return obj;
165f7b77691SDoug Rabson }
166f7b77691SDoug Rabson 
167f7b77691SDoug Rabson void
168f7b77691SDoug Rabson kobj_init(kobj_t obj, kobj_class_t cls)
169f7b77691SDoug Rabson {
170f7b77691SDoug Rabson 	/*
171f7b77691SDoug Rabson 	 * Consider compiling the class' method table.
172f7b77691SDoug Rabson 	 */
173f7b77691SDoug Rabson 	if (!cls->ops)
174f7b77691SDoug Rabson 		kobj_class_compile(cls);
175f7b77691SDoug Rabson 
176f7b77691SDoug Rabson 	obj->ops = cls->ops;
1774b4a49fdSDoug Rabson 	cls->refs++;
178f7b77691SDoug Rabson }
179f7b77691SDoug Rabson 
180f7b77691SDoug Rabson void
181f7b77691SDoug Rabson kobj_delete(kobj_t obj, struct malloc_type *mtype)
182f7b77691SDoug Rabson {
183f7b77691SDoug Rabson 	kobj_class_t cls = obj->ops->cls;
184f7b77691SDoug Rabson 
185f7b77691SDoug Rabson 	/*
186f7b77691SDoug Rabson 	 * Consider freeing the compiled method table for the class
187f7b77691SDoug Rabson 	 * after its last instance is deleted. As an optimisation, we
188f7b77691SDoug Rabson 	 * should defer this for a short while to avoid thrashing.
189f7b77691SDoug Rabson 	 */
1904b4a49fdSDoug Rabson 	cls->refs--;
1914b4a49fdSDoug Rabson 	if (!cls->refs)
192f7b77691SDoug Rabson 		kobj_class_free(cls);
193f7b77691SDoug Rabson 
194f7b77691SDoug Rabson 	obj->ops = 0;
195f7b77691SDoug Rabson 	if (mtype)
196f7b77691SDoug Rabson 		free(obj, mtype);
197f7b77691SDoug Rabson }
